Transaction 56564daeb6ae8ce7926d0f9c07308f0d4e48ab04ecaaabfcafc0a81314ed9646
1 Input
1 Output
-
56564daeb6ae8ce7926d0f9c07308f0d4e48ab04ecaaabfcafc0a81314ed9646:0
- value
- 3856282
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c4ed9ccf707aab6440dddafa863177ec9d616a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KdHJnMLoz6RVi66DSZ9e2d1XUrRAxqjQv